  • The Wachowski Brothers have done it again- An Incredible film to follow The Matrix!

    A terrorist in a futuristic dictatorship of Great Britain known only as V (Hugo Weaving) goes on British Television and declares that November 5th of next year will be known as a day for revolution against the dictatorship that they live in. In the course of waiting for that day to come, V spends his time with a young girl named Evey Hammond (Natalie Portman).

    We first saw such brilliance from the Wachowski Brothers with The Matrix and they do not disappoint with V for Vendetta. This film is incredible in every aspect. It is clever, entertaining, artistic, thrilling, dramatic, and even humorous at times. Blending 1984 themes with a superhero background, V for Vendetta focuses on realistic concepts of government and fear that face us every day. Frighteningly close to what could be our future, "V" opens our eyes to the world we live in as well as entertaining us with incredible fight scenes and fast-paced action. Everything about this film is wonderful including a brilliantly wonderful performance by Natalie Portman and incredible direction by James McTeigue with writing that is to die for. Overall, this film is incredible on all accounts. I have only one thing to say to the Wachowski Brothers. Bravo. Bravo.

    I highly recommend this film.

  • An original and entertaining beginning to what could be a wonderful trilogy.

    To end a catastrophic battle in ancient history, the others (People who possess various supernatural powers) signed a truce between dark and light. This truce ensured that no side will influence another other's choice of which side they want to be on and that the night will belong to the light, to make sure that the dark doesn't break the agreement. The day will belong to the dark to ensure the same. In present day Moscow, a man named Anton Gorodetsky helps ensure the balance at all costs.

    What makes this film so entertaining and promising is that it is original in most aspects. It holds basic themes like Good vs. Evil, but still finds itself to be original, which is hard to find in modern day cinema. It seems like everything has been done. Night Watch proves that there is creativity out there and with two more films on the way, you can be sure that you will hear more about these films. Being as Russian film, the movie is mainly in sub-titles but this is a good thing, because you learn to read facial expressions in a film that its drama is based on. And let me just say that this film is entertaining to the end. It may not be the greatest film ever, but not one moment of it is dull. Every second, I felt as if I was watching Star Wars for the first time. On top of it all, the ending was incredible. It doesn't actually end though so ill say how it begins is amazing. Overall, I can't wait to see the next two films after witnessing such wonderful entertainment. This could have been the most promising film of the year.

    I recommend this film.

  • A long boring conversation...

    Jill Johnson (Camilla Belle) is a high school student who has just recently broke up with her boyfriend and in an attempt to pay back her parents for cell phone bills, must watch over a doctor's kids in his gigantic house. While keeping herself entertained as the kids sleep, she is greeted with a phone call from a stranger who won't stop calling. What she finds out next is a bigger surprise- the stranger is calling from inside the house.

    This is another horror remake and not a very entertaining one at that. The movie dragged along with the phone tag and then just spat out action all at once in an UN-impressive fashion. It was extremely UN-realistic just as you might expect. Jill Johnson is wonder woman compared to the serial killer who has killed a huge amount of young girls with his bare hands! All of this could have been predicted and the film did not surprise me in any way other than wonderful cinematography. I could never have imagined that such a film as this could ever have great cinematography but it did. But things like that don't make a movie! There needs to be a lot more. Overall, the film was just another disappointing teenager horror film and their will be more like it because teenagers love to see crappy PG-13 films. When will it end? I do not recommend this film.
